Islom Goes Xinjiang
Want-away Grilled Birds forward
Islom Davlatov secured the move his was looking for, as he was picked up by Chinese Division Two club Karamay FC, widely acknowledged as currently the strongest in the Xinjiang region.
Grilled head coach
Hovaness Noubaryan hailed this as a win for all sides. "Davlatov returns closer home with more-guaranteed playing time, Karamay FC get a technically outstanding attacker with some top seasons ahead of him - he's still 32 only - and we get to introduce new blood, shore up other positions."
Noubaryan did add that Karamay FC were tough negotiators. "We were looking for at least S$10 million, but they managed to take another half million off that."
This then closes the chapter on Davlatov's ten season plus stay at the Birds, in which he made 160 competitive appearances, scored 85 goals in those, lifted two national Challenger Cups, and was honoured as the club's best player for Season 67.
